Anyone else hear Barton Simmons on ESPN U radio a little while ago? They asked him about Tennessee, and to my surprise he was relatively upbeat, said obviously we're not seeing the results on the field that we would like, but he was confident that with our staff we would be able to continue to recruit well and get this turned around.

He was asked specifically about our current transfers leaving the program and he alluded to Butch Jones classes being recruits that were more interested in being recruited than they were playing football.

He went on the say that the 2019 class were football players first and foremost. Seemed to think the blueprint for that class and future classes is correct and will help right the ship.

I thought it was interesting to say the least.
